1. INTRODUCTION

In advising Themba, Ndumi, and Freddy on the validity of their intended
partnership to sell solar batteries, it is important to assess whether their agreement
meets the legal requirements of a partnership under South African law. A
partnership is a contract based on consensus between two or more persons who
agree to carry on a business together with the aim of making a profit, and to
contribute to the business by money, property, or services.

To determine whether a valid partnership can exist, we must consider:

 The definition and essential elements of a partnership.
 The legality and sufficiency of the contributions by each party.
 The enforceability of conditional contributions.
 The implications for the overall validity of the partnership agreement.
